
Based on your book
by Jones, Diana Wynne
Sophie Hatter is cursed into an old woman's body by a spiteful witch, prompting her to leave her dull life behind and seek refuge in the wandering, chaotic fortress belonging to the notorious Wizard Howl. What follows is not a standard fairy tale quest, but a messy, witty, and deeply human comedy of errors. Jones excels at making magic feel like a daily chore rather than a grand, distant phenomenon. The pacing is snappy, driven by the constant bickering between a vain, cowardly wizard and a heroine whose newfound old age gives her the confidence to speak her mind. If you enjoy stories where the protagonist is delightfully prickly and the world-building feels lived-in and slightly askew, this will become an instant favorite. It is perfect for readers who prefer their whimsy served with a side of sharp-tongued sarcasm.
